Canaan Dog Temperament

The Canaan Dog is a distinctive breed renowned for its deeply ingrained survival instincts and profound loyalty to its family. With an energy level of 4 out of 5 and exercise needs also at 4 out of 5, they thrive on activity and engagement. Their temperament is characterized by being Alert, Loyal, Vigilant, Intelligent, and Independent. This combination makes them exceptional watchdogs, always aware of their surroundings and quick to notice anything unusual. A Canaan Dog’s loyalty runs deep, forming strong bonds with their household, often expressed through their watchful nature. Their intelligence means they are capable of learning, but their independent streak, with a trainability level of 3 out of 5, suggests they require consistent and patient training from an owner who understands their unique mindset. Daily life with a Canaan Dog involves managing their high barking level of 4 out of 5, especially given their vigilant nature. They are not apartment-friendly and do best in homes with space to accommodate their medium size (35-55 lbs). While good with kids, their dynamic with other pets is less straightforward, as they are noted as not being good with other pets. Owners should be prepared for an active companion who appreciates a predictable routine and firm, fair guidance.

Owner Fit Summary

The Canaan Dog usually does better in homes with a bit more room, is generally a good fit for families with children, and may need slower introductions around other pets. Owners should expect a high energy companion with substantial daily exercise and a trainability level of 3/5.

Care Snapshot

In practical terms, the Canaan Dog brings steady weekly grooming, noticeable shedding around the home, and a vocal household. That mix matters just as much as temperament when deciding whether this breed fits your daily routine.
